Miller, Thomas (T.) Photo
Rank Sapper
Service # 2006411
Unit # Canadian Engineers, 69th Can Waggon Coy.
Resident Chatham
Books Of Rememberance Page Available

Sapper Thomas Miller enlisted at Hamilton in Canadian Engineers July 24th 1917 Crossed to England Jan 1918 and to France in Feb and joined 69th Can Waggon Coy. He left France in March 1919 and arrived in Canada at the end of that month.

Discharged at London April 3rd 1919 due to demobilization.

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ION

Sources Chatham Daily Planet (07-07-1919)
Height 5'2'
Eye Colour Blue
Age 27
Complexion Fair
Hair Fair
Race White
Birthplace Liverpool, England
Religion Anglican
Last Place of Employment Hamilton Slate Roofing Company
Average Earnings $ 4.00 per day
Marital Status Married
Marriage Info November 29th, 1913, Hamilton, Ontario.
When Enlisted July 24th, 1917
Where Enlisted Hamilton, Ontario
Allowance from Patriotic Fund $ 14.00 per month
Next of Kin Wife- Mrs. Flossie Miller, Chatham. Son- Thomas Miller.
